The buddleia that I rescued from last year's extreme weeding of the driveway has grown at a ridiculous rate this year. It's currently flowering and we've never had so many butterflies in the garden, they really do love it. There were cabbage white, peacocks and red admirals all hanging out -the red admiral being the one that wasn't spooked by the camera. Back to work after the bank holiday tomorrow..
